> I have an ESS Audiodrive 16bit soundcard, however my sound player
> routines will only play back 22khz or lower sounds.
The Audiodrive only emulates the SB-Pro 8 bit interface, so you need
to support it to get 16 bit output or higher sample rates. Recent
WIP versions of the Allegro library (see
http://www.talula.demon.co.uk/allegro/wip.html) include a native
ESS driver.
